浏览代码

促销活动创建领域获取优化

eganwu 1 年之前
父节点
当前提交
fe284d99e1
共有 1 个文件被更改,包括 4 次插入2 次删除
  1. 4 2
      src/custom/restcontroller/webmanage/sale/order/Order.java

+ 4 - 2
src/custom/restcontroller/webmanage/sale/order/Order.java

@@ -302,9 +302,11 @@ public class Order extends Controller {
 //            return getErrReturnObject().setErrMsg("请添加同一领域的商品").toString();
 //        }
         if (sa_promotionid > 0) {
-            Rows rows = dbConnect.runSqlQuery("SELECT * from sa_promotion WHERE sa_promotionid=" + sa_promotionid + " and siteid='" + siteid + "'");
+            Rows rows = dbConnect.runSqlQuery("SELECT ifnull(tradefield,'[]') tradefield  from sa_promotion WHERE sa_promotionid=" + sa_promotionid + " and siteid='" + siteid + "'");
             if (rows.isNotEmpty()) {
-                tradefield = rows.get(0).getString("tradefield");
+                String tradefields = rows.get(0).getString("tradefield");
+                JSONArray jsonArray = JSONArray.parseArray(tradefields);
+                tradefield = StringUtils.join(jsonArray, ",");
             }
         }